Media Manager and Reverse Proxy HTTPS Offloading Citrix Netscaler

Hello,
 
we have deployed Polycom Media Manager in DMZ, using a Citrix Netscaler as a reverse proxy for internet access. But we have some problem on this scenario. Maybe someone could help.
 
1. Mediamanager will publish on internet trough Citrix Netscaler that will provide reverse proxy and https offloading (the https request on internet will be proxied to http on the Mediamanager).
2. Mediamanager can work in this scenario?
3. There is some drawback or technical limitations for this scenario?
4. There are some techinical limitations when we use rewriting or url transformations?
5. Do you have some use case/deployment guide about this scenario (or a similar scenario)?

Gian, 

 

This falls into the “not tested, not supported, but might work” category as long as the url transformations are invisible to the MM. 

 

We know that others have tried similar ways to have HTTPS setup externally from IIS itself and we have seen that this does not work well with Microsoft Silverlight at this and will not play back streams. 

 

I do not recommend it.
